New Mexican low cost carrier start-up VivaAerobus (http://www.vivaaerobus.com/?lng=2e8356f8-1dae-4cb3-9387-8b89101a0cb5) is offering $9 base fares each way on its nonstop flights between AUS (Austin) and Cancun (CUN) with a five-week advance purchase and, of course, subject to availability.

The taxes from AUS-CUN run $45.00 and taxes from CUN-AUS are $73.99. There is also a $8 credit card booking fee per reservation (not per person).

VB #920 from AUS-CUN departs at 8:45 a.m. and arrive at 11:00 a.m. VB #921 from CUN-AUS departs at 11:25 a.m. and arrives at 1:45 p.m.

Fair warning: VivaAerobus is partially owned by the founder of RyanAir. So expect the RyanAir travel experience, minus the hassle of a bus ride to a remote airport and minus the inability to talk to a human being, as VivaAerobus actually maintains a toll free number in the U.S., although I was on hold so long when I called that I gave up before talking to a human being. The flights are operated by 737-300 aircraft and feature open seating and drinks and snacks for sale.

We flew with 'em in July. Our flight times changed by 20 minutes or so, but that was about it as far as schedule changes.

VivaAerobus is a basic, no frills carrier. You'll have to buy beverages and food on board if you are thirsty or hungry, but the prices are very reasonable. Boarding is by groups, with assignments based upon check-in time. Having a young child, as we did, allowed us to board first and grab the bulkhead row, which had tons of legroom. VivaAerobus flies out of the South Terminal at AUS so make sure you head for the right parking lot. Parking is $10/day for the first three days and $7/day thereafter.
